Roles and Responsibilities:


Infrastructure Architecture & Administration

  • Platform Management: Oversee the full lifecycle—architecture, deployment, patching, clustering, and health monitoring—of core SOC platforms (SIEM, SOAR, EDR, TIP).
  • Data Pipeline Engineering: Architect and manage high-volume data ingestion pipelines, ensuring logs from cloud environments, networks, and endpoints are cleanly parsed, normalized, and indexed.
  • Storage & Retention Optimization: Optimize index storage strategies, hot/cold data tier configurations, and long-term compliance log archival to balance operational speed with hardware costs.

Automation & Integration (SOAR)

  • API Integration: Connect disparate security platforms, infrastructure systems, and identity providers by writing robust, secure custom API integrations.
  • Playbook Infrastructure: Engineer the backend infrastructure, actions, and custom connectors required for Tier-2 and Incident Response teams to execute automated response playbooks.
  • Agent Deployment: Partner with IT and DevOps teams to manage the automated enterprise-wide deployment, tuning, and health verification of EDR and logging agents.

Performance Tuning & Reliability

  • Query Performance Optimization: Audit, test, and tune complex analytical queries (e.g., Splunk SPL, Sentinel KQL) written by detection engineers to prevent system resource exhaustion.
  • High Availability: Implement and test robust backup, disaster recovery, and failover strategies for all critical SOC infrastructure components to guarantee 24/7/365 uptime.


Technical Skills & Tools

Platform Infrastructure & Engineering

  • SIEM/Data Lake Engineering: Deep architectural knowledge of enterprise platforms, such as Splunk Enterprise (Clustering, Indexer/Search Head architecture), Microsoft Sentinel, Elastic Cloud (ELK), or Cribl Stream.
  • SOAR Infrastructure: Infrastructure-level experience managing orchestration engines like Palo Alto Cortex XSOAR, Splunk SOAR, or Swimlane.
  • DevOps & Infrastructure as Code (IaC): High proficiency deploying infrastructure and configurations using Terraform, Ansible, Docker, or Kubernetes clusters.

Linux Administration & Scripting

  • System Administration: Enterprise-level Linux (RHEL, Ubuntu) and Windows Server systems administration, including performance tuning, daemon management, and access controls.
  • Automation Languages: Advanced scripting capabilities in Python, Bash, or Go to build automated utilities, parse custom logs, and manipulate JSON/XML payloads over REST APIs.
  • Cloud Architecture: Deep experience managing native security logging mechanisms across AWS (CloudTrail, VPC Flow), Azure (Event Hubs), and GCP (Pub/Sub).


Experience & Qualifications

Required Experience

  • Total Systems Engineering Experience: Minimum of 5–7+ years of professional experience in Infrastructure Engineering, DevOps, Cloud Architectures, or Enterprise Systems Administration.
  • Splunk Platform Engineering Footprint: At least 3+ years of dedicated experience architecting, deploying, and maintaining large-scale Splunk environments, with explicit responsibility for managing Splunk Enterprise Security (ES) premium applications.
  • Architecture Scale: Documented history of engineering multi-tier Splunk environments (Clustered Indexers, Search Head Clusters, deployment servers) handling multi-terabyte per day data ingestion pipelines.


Splunk ES Specialized Experience

  • Data Model Acceleration: Proven experience configuring, tuning, and troubleshooting Data Model Accelerations (DMA) within Splunk ES to keep search head performance optimized without exhausting storage or CPU infrastructure.
  • CIM Compliance Engineering: Mastery of mapping unstructured log sources (firewall, cloud, identity, endpoint) to the Splunk Common Information Model (CIM) to ensure seamless alerting inside the ES incident review dashboard.
  • RBA Implementation: Direct hands-on experience structuring infrastructure to support Splunk Risk-Based Alerting (RBA) frameworks, including managing risk indexes and object attributions.
  • Data Stream Optimization: Proficiency utilizing Splunk Heavy Forwarders, Splunk Stream, or edge-routing technology (e.g., Cribl Stream, Kafka) to mask, filter, and drop duplicate event streams before they impact Splunk licensing costs.
